Tactile Hallucinations
False perceptions of touch or bodily sensations, often experienced without external stimuli, commonly associated with certain mental disorders.
Neuropsychological Battery
A comprehensive assessment using a series of tests to measure cognitive function and brain behavior relationships, often following brain injury or neurological disease.
Diagnosis
The identification of the nature of an illness or other problem by examination of the symptoms.
Validity
The extent to which a test, tool, or research study measures what it purports to measure.
